UNREST IN MEXICO
A GENERAL ASSASSINATED. By Telegraph—Press Assn.—Copyright. Received March 16, 8.30 p.m. A. and N.Z. Mexico City, March 15. General Gaxiola, secretary to President Obregon for the Presidential organisation, and candidate for the Governorship of the State of Sinaloa, has been assassinated at Culiacan.
